Latest Patents
Philippe Lucienne holds a patent for a hydraulic machine that comprises bearings for supporting the rotating component. This innovative design includes a housing, a shaft movably mounted relative to the housing about an axis, and an apron rigidly connected to the shaft. The machine also features a cam connected to either the housing or the shaft, along with a cylinder block that is rotationally connected to the other component. The cylinder block contains pistons that engage with the cam to produce relative rotation between the shaft and the housing. Additionally, the design incorporates first and second guide bearings that bear directly on the housing and the apron, as well as a third guide bearing that bears directly on the housing and the cylinder block.
